COM. v. PALAGONIA


868 A.2d 1212 (2005)

COMMONWEALTH of Pennsylvania, Appellee, v. Charles A. PALAGONIA, Appellant.

Superior Court of Pennsylvania.

Filed February 9, 2005.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Brian J. Collins, Allentown, for appellant.

David D. Ritter, Asst. Dist. Atty., Allentown, for Com., appellee.

BEFORE: HUDOCK, TODD and BECK, JJ.


OPINION BY BECK, J.:

¶ 1 In this appeal from the judgment of sentence for criminal trespass and related crimes, appellant claims that the evidence was insufficient and that the trial court erred in admitting certain evidence of the prosecution and excluding proffered evidence for the defense. We affirm.
